Understanding Wind Protection Netting
Wind protection netting plays a pivotal role in the construction industry, serving as an essential component that enhances safety and environmental control at job sites. This specialized mesh material is engineered to withstand harsh weather conditions while ensuring optimal performance throughout its application.
Material Composition and Properties
The backbone of effective wind protection netting lies in its high-quality construction. Typically manufactured from UV-stabilized HDPE (High-Density Polyethylene), these nets exhibit remarkable strength and durability. This specific polymer not only offers superior weather resistance but also contributes to the longevity of the product, making it suitable for both short-term and long-term uses.
Advantages of UV-Stabilized HDPE
- Weather Resistance: The UV stabilization protects the netting from degradation caused by prolonged sunlight exposure.
- High Strength: Capable of withstanding strong winds without tearing or sagging.
- Lightweight: Easy to handle during installation and removal, which streamlines the workflow on-site.
Applications in Construction Sites
Wind protection netting is versatile, effectively used in various applications including scaffolding, building facades, temporary fencing, and renovation projects. Its multi-faceted utility makes it a valuable asset across numerous construction sectors.
Safety Enhancements
One of the primary functions of this type of netting is to create a safer working environment. By reducing the risk of falling objects and limiting dust dispersion, it contributes significantly to on-site safety. Workers benefit from a well-protected area that minimizes hazards related to debris and airborne particles.
Design Specifications
Construction protection mesh is available in a variety of colors, widths, lengths, and weights, catering to diverse project needs. This customization allows contractors to choose specifications that best fit their project's requirements while maintaining compliance with safety standards.
Reinforced Edges for Enhanced Security
To ensure reliable performance, the edges of the protection mesh are typically reinforced, allowing for secure fastening to structures or anchors. This feature minimizes the risk of detachment and ensures that the netting remains securely in place, even in windy conditions.
Installation Considerations
Installation of wind protection netting is straightforward due to its lightweight nature. However, proper procedures must be followed to maximize effectiveness and safety. It is recommended to assess site-specific factors such as wind direction, expected load, and potential obstacles before installation.
Recommendations for Effective Use
- Ensure proper tensioning during installation to prevent sagging.
- Regularly inspect the netting for wear and tear, especially after extreme weather events.
- Consider using multiple layers in areas prone to high winds for added protection.
